Hidden in the Heart by Roseanne E. Wilkins

Cathee is an active member of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ints. She has suffered from severe post traumatic stress disorder for several years.

During a vacation with her four year old daughter to Topeka, Kansas, she meets Garrett, a therapist. He hopes Cathee will let him help her work through her issues, but her past has come back to haunt her.


Roseanne Evans Wilkins: was the second oldest of 9 children, so I grew up in a house full of noisy kids. Craig grew up in a house with just 2 quiet kids. Opposites attract lol. Since I’m the one home, we filled the house with kids. I’d go crazy with silence. Craig manages the noise level by traveling all over the U.S. teaching other adults how to audit.

With 5 kids in sports, I keep busy running them to their practices and games. After hectic days running kids everywhere and taking care of three pre-schoolers, I find quiet time after everyone is in bed to write. I hope you enjoy the results :).

Through Love’s Trials by Julie Coulter Bellon

Kenneth King, a successful Arizona attorney, finds himself facing the most difficult trial of his life—and it’s not in a courtroom. He’s asked to deliver a mysterious disk to Emma James an attorney in Utah, but as soon as Kenneth agrees to it, his life is turned upside down. His home is broken into, he’s shot at, and an attorney at his firm is murdered. Is he next?

Kenneth contacts Emma, and is drawn to her immediately, but she is a strong-willed single mother who doesn’t want anything to do with the disk—or with him. However, when Emma suffers a brutal assault that is possibly linked to the disk, Emma’s father, an agent in the Canadian Security Intelligence Service steps in to help Kenneth protect her and find out who wants them dead.

The tension builds as Kenneth and Emma find themselves in a race against time to stop an attack on North America’s defenses. Will the Canadian government be able to help them before the United States is attacked? Will Kenneth and Emma let down their defenses enough to make it through love’s trials?

Julie Bellon and her husband Brian are the parents of eight children. Julie’s greatest joy is being a mother and spending time with her family. She graduated from Brigham Young University with a Bachelor’s degree in Secondary Education—English teaching, and she currently teaches a journalism course for BYU Continuing Education. When she’s not busy being a mom, teaching, serving in the community or writing, you will find her browsing through bookstores to add to her book collection, at the library borrowing books, or reading the treasures she’s found.


Veiled by S.B. Niccum


“I have always existed, not just me but all of us, the un-embodied spirits who wait to live.”

Tess is an unborn spirit, who is about to embark on a much awaited journey into mortality to a brand new planet called Earth. She is chosen by the Eternals for an important mission, and is put under a rigorous training by a half-human, half-lion Seraph. This training exposes Tess to some of her darkest fears and insecurities. These experiences force Tess to work on her gift as a discerner of thoughts and reader of auras—thus helping her become one of Heaven’s most powerful angels.

But even angels falter, and deep inside her a gnawing fear is growing. Will she meet her soul mate in life? Will their love be strong enough to overcome the forgetting effects of the Veil? And, is she prepared to take on the responsibility of keeping the most dangerous renegade and leader of the Fallen Angels at bay during mortality?


S.B. Niccum: Silvina B. Niccum was born in Rosario, Argentina and raised in Buenos Aires. Her family immigrated to the US, when she was fourteen. She attended the University of Utah and studied Spanish Literature. Silvina now lives in Dallas, TX. with her husband and her three homeschooled children.
